To understand why the fourth installment succeeded, you must first understand the shockwaves caused by the original. Before the Taboo series, the concept of incest—specifically mother-son relationships—was largely considered the final frontier of cinematic prohibition.
The first Taboo film, in particular, is regarded as a landmark in adult cinema. It was one of the first feature‑length porn films to deal explicitly with the incest theme, and it did so in a way that provoked serious thought and discussion about the nature of desire and taboo. The series as a whole was inducted into the XRCO Hall of Fame, a testament to its lasting significance within the industry. Later entries, while profitable, never achieved this level of cultural resonance and are largely forgotten outside of hardcore completionists.
